A Simple Anchor Plan?


A question that is often asked is: How many anchors does it take to cover a given space?
Although this may seem like a simple geometry question, It can be fairly difficult to answer, especially when walls or other obstructions share the space.
Here are some general guidelines to keep in mind:

  1. CPE Anchors can be daisy-chained together to reduce POE wiring.
  2. A staggerd 15mx15m anchor placement is usually sufficient.
  3. A 20mx20m pattern is considered minimal.
  4. When simple walls intervene, anchor separation should be reduced to 10m or less.
  5. Isolated rooms require 4-6 anchors for good coverage.
  6. The chosen RTLS algorithm and required solution quality should also be accounted for.
